Excerpt from A Practical Guide, to Coco-Nut Planting
This book on Coco-nut Cultivation is the outcome of a request made by the Government of the Federated Malay States for an enlarge ment of Mr. Brown's Bulletin No. II, written on the same subject in 1910, and is by no means intended to be an Enquire Within about everything connected with the coco-nut.
In acceding to this request it was decided, in order that the work might be as useful as possible, to bring it out in its present form abundantly and suitably illustrated.

This book is a practical guide to coconut cultivation, with a focus on the conditions found in Malaysia, Indonesia, and other regions of the Malay Archipelago. The author, who has extensive experience in the field, provides detailed instructions on all aspects of coconut cultivation, from selecting and preparing the land to planting, maintaining, and harvesting the crop. The book also covers topics such as controlling pests and diseases, managing soil fertility, and processing the coconut fruit. The author emphasizes the importance of proper cultivation techniques to ensure a productive and sustainable coconut plantation. By following the author's recommendations, readers can gain the knowledge and skills necessary to successfully establish and manage a profitable coconut cultivation operation.
